Skype
The Research Library provides outside-the-firewall access to Skype in our conference rooms. This is a great way to stay connected with co-authors and to interview prospective job candidates in a very cost-effective way.
Skype allows users to see each other face-to-face and communicate via voice audio and live chat during the Skype session. For security and bandwidth concerns, Skype is only available on selected outside-the-firewall workstations at the Board like those designated workstations in the Research Library.
